Bulk Material Handling System Market Overview 2025-2035

The global Bulk Material Handling System Market is poised for significant expansion, driven by the increasing demand for automation and efficiency in industries such as mining, construction, agriculture, and manufacturing. The market size is projected to reach USD 65.8 billion by 2033, up from USD 42.7 billion in 2026, reflecting a robust CAGR of 6.4% during the forecast period. The adoption of advanced technologies, such as IoT-enabled monitoring and predictive maintenance, is further accelerating market growth by enhancing operational reliability and reducing downtime.

Bulk material handling systems are integral to optimizing supply chain operations, reducing labor costs, and improving workplace safety. The market is witnessing a shift towards environmentally sustainable solutions, with manufacturers focusing on energy-efficient equipment and dust control systems. As industries continue to scale up production capacities and automate material flow processes, the demand for sophisticated bulk material handling solutions is expected to surge globally.

Bulk Material Handling System Market Trends

  1. Integration of Automation and Digital Technologies
    The Bulk Material Handling System Market is experiencing a paradigm shift with the integration of automation, robotics, and digital technologies. Automated guided vehicles (AGVs), programmable logic controllers (PLCs), and IoT-enabled sensors are being increasingly deployed to monitor and control material flow in real-time. This trend is enhancing operational efficiency, reducing human error, and enabling predictive maintenance. The adoption of digital twins and advanced analytics is further optimizing system performance, allowing operators to simulate processes, identify bottlenecks, and implement corrective actions proactively.
  2. Focus on Sustainability and Energy Efficiency
    Environmental sustainability is becoming a central theme in the bulk material handling industry. Manufacturers are developing energy-efficient equipment, such as low-power conveyors and regenerative braking systems, to minimize energy consumption and carbon emissions. Additionally, dust control and noise reduction technologies are being integrated to comply with stringent environmental regulations. The emphasis on green operations is not only helping companies reduce their environmental footprint but also improving their brand reputation and competitiveness in the global market.
  3. Customization and Modular System Design
    The demand for customized and modular bulk material handling solutions is on the rise, as industries seek systems that can be tailored to specific operational requirements. Modular designs allow for easy scalability and flexibility, enabling companies to adapt to changing production volumes and material types. This trend is particularly prominent in sectors such as mining and construction, where material characteristics and throughput requirements can vary significantly. Customization is also facilitating the integration of advanced safety features and automation technologies, further enhancing system reliability and performance.

Segment & Category Analysis for Bulk Material Handling System Market

By Equipment Type

  • Conveyors
  • Stackers & Reclaimers
  • Crushers
  • Feeders
  • Hoppers & Silos
  • Bucket Elevators
  • Ship Loaders & Unloaders

The equipment type segment is fundamental to the Bulk Material Handling System Market, as it encompasses the core machinery used for transporting, storing, and processing bulk materials. Conveyors dominate this segment due to their versatility and widespread application across industries. Stackers and reclaimers are essential for efficient storage and retrieval in bulk terminals, while crushers and feeders are critical in mining and aggregate processing. The demand for advanced, automated equipment is rising, driven by the need for higher throughput, reduced maintenance, and improved safety. Manufacturers are focusing on modular and energy-efficient designs to cater to diverse operational requirements.

By Material Type

  • Coal
  • Aggregates
  • Grains
  • Minerals & Ores
  • Chemicals
  • Biomass

Material type segmentation is crucial, as different materials require specialized handling solutions. Coal and aggregates are the most commonly handled materials, particularly in mining and construction. Grains and biomass are significant in the agriculture and power generation sectors, respectively. The handling of chemicals and minerals necessitates systems with enhanced safety features to prevent contamination and ensure regulatory compliance. The diversity of materials underscores the importance of versatile and adaptable bulk material handling systems that can accommodate varying physical and chemical properties.

By Application

  • Loading & Unloading
  • Storage & Warehousing
  • Transportation
  • Processing

Application-based segmentation provides insights into the specific functions performed by bulk material handling systems. Loading and unloading operations are critical in ports, warehouses, and manufacturing plants, requiring efficient and reliable equipment to minimize turnaround times. Storage and warehousing applications demand systems that optimize space utilization and ensure material integrity. Transportation involves the movement of bulk materials over short and long distances, necessitating robust conveyors and transfer systems. Processing applications, such as crushing and screening, require specialized equipment to prepare materials for further use or sale.

By End-Use Industry

  • Mining
  • Construction
  • Agriculture
  • Power Generation
  • Chemicals
  • Food & Beverage

End-use industry segmentation highlights the diverse applications of bulk material handling systems. Mining remains the largest end-user, given the high volume of materials processed and the need for robust, reliable equipment. Construction and agriculture sectors are also significant contributors, utilizing these systems for handling aggregates, grains, and fertilizers. The power generation industry relies on bulk handling for coal and biomass, while the chemicals and food & beverage sectors require specialized systems to manage sensitive or hazardous materials. Each industry presents unique challenges, driving demand for customized solutions that ensure efficiency, safety, and regulatory compliance.

Growth Restrain Factors and Challenges in Bulk Material Handling System Market

  • High Initial Investment and Maintenance Costs

The substantial capital investment required for the installation and commissioning of bulk material handling systems is a significant restraint for market growth. Small and medium-sized enterprises (SMEs), in particular, may find it challenging to allocate resources for advanced, automated systems. Additionally, the ongoing maintenance and repair costs can be considerable, especially for equipment operating in harsh environments. These financial barriers may limit the adoption of bulk material handling solutions, particularly in price-sensitive markets.

Furthermore, the complexity of modern bulk material handling systems necessitates skilled personnel for operation and maintenance. The shortage of qualified technicians can lead to increased downtime and reduced system efficiency. Companies must invest in training and development programs to ensure their workforce is equipped to manage advanced equipment, adding to the overall cost of ownership.

  • Regulatory Compliance and Environmental Concerns

Stringent regulatory requirements related to workplace safety, environmental protection, and emissions control pose challenges for bulk material handling system manufacturers and end-users. Compliance with these regulations often requires the implementation of additional safety features, dust suppression systems, and noise reduction technologies, which can increase system complexity and cost. Non-compliance can result in fines, legal liabilities, and reputational damage.

Environmental concerns, such as dust generation, noise pollution, and energy consumption, are also becoming increasingly important. Companies must balance the need for efficient material handling with the imperative to minimize their environmental footprint. This requires continuous innovation and investment in sustainable technologies, which may not be feasible for all market participants.

Bulk Material Handling System Market Regional Analysis

RegionMarket Share (2025)Key Market Highlight
Asia-Pacific38%Rapid industrialization and infrastructure growth, especially in China and India
North America24%High adoption of automation and advanced technologies in mining and manufacturing
Europe20%Strong focus on sustainability and regulatory compliance in bulk handling operations
South America10%Growing mining sector and increasing investment in port infrastructure
Middle East & Africa8%Expansion of construction and energy projects driving demand for bulk handling systems

Asia-Pacific

Asia-Pacific leads the Bulk Material Handling System Market, accounting for the largest share due to rapid industrialization, urbanization, and infrastructure development in countries such as China, India, and Southeast Asian nations. The region’s mining, construction, and agriculture sectors are major consumers of bulk material handling equipment. Government initiatives to boost manufacturing and export activities are further fueling market growth. The increasing adoption of automation and digital technologies is enhancing operational efficiency and safety across industries.

North America

North America is a mature market characterized by high adoption of advanced technologies and automation in bulk material handling. The region’s mining, manufacturing, and food processing industries are key end-users. Stringent safety and environmental regulations are driving the adoption of energy-efficient and environmentally friendly equipment. The presence of leading market players and ongoing investments in research and development are supporting market growth. The trend towards digitalization and smart supply chain integration is also prominent in this region.

Europe

Europe’s Bulk Material Handling System Market is driven by a strong focus on sustainability, regulatory compliance, and technological innovation. The region’s mining, construction, and chemical industries are significant users of bulk handling systems. European companies are at the forefront of developing green technologies and energy-efficient equipment. The emphasis on workplace safety and environmental protection is shaping market dynamics, with manufacturers investing in advanced dust control and noise reduction solutions.

South America

South America is experiencing steady growth in the Bulk Material Handling System Market, supported by the expansion of the mining sector and increasing investment in port and logistics infrastructure. Countries such as Brazil and Chile are major contributors, with significant mineral resources and export activities. The region’s construction and agriculture sectors are also driving demand for bulk handling equipment. However, economic volatility and regulatory challenges may impact market growth in certain countries.

Middle East & Africa

The Middle East & Africa region is witnessing growing demand for bulk material handling systems, driven by large-scale construction, energy, and mining projects. The expansion of ports, industrial zones, and energy infrastructure is creating opportunities for market participants. The region’s focus on diversifying economies and attracting foreign investment is supporting industrial growth. However, political instability and fluctuating commodity prices may pose challenges to sustained market expansion.
